Yidi Wang (王一迪)

Pyraminx · top 32.9% of 129,321 all-time · competing since June 2018 · 2018WANY18

Yidi Wang (王一迪) has been competing for 8 years. Her best event is the Pyraminx: a personal-best single of 7.61, set at Harbin Open 2018, puts her in the top 32.9% of the 129,321 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 3,620th in China. Across 1 competition since June 2018, she has put 14 official solves on the record across three events.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
